Shipping Container Delivery

Shipping Container Delivery

All our units are normally delivered by HIAB lorry. On sites with restricted access, we may need to use an alternate delivery method such as a forklift or a telescopic handler.

Our Sales Team will get in touch once you have placed the order to discuss and arrange the delivery with you. In the rare cases when we cannot get all the information about site access over the phone or using satellite and street views, we can offer a site visit to assess whether or not delivery is possible.

The maximum capacity of a lorry is the equivalent to one 40ft container. The delivery cost is calculated depending on the container size and the distance from your local depot to the provided delivery postcode when placing your order.

If we have stock of the size and colour of the shipping container you want to order, we will aim to deliver within 5 to 10 working days. Please note that delivery times vary depending on stock availability, time of the year and your location.

FAQs

Delivery of a shipping container can be achieved by crane assisted vehicle or by a regular LGV if you have your own lifting facilities. Do make sure you have sufficient space for the vehicle to manoeuvre. Vehicle sizes and capabilities do vary, so you will need to discuss this with our sales team before delivery commences, which will save both time and money.

The structure of the container is designed to be supported by four corners with a full load should you require it. The land base could be grass or soil but it must be firm throughout the duration of the container placement. Also the ground should be level helping the container to remain stable. The doors may become difficult to open or indeed worse if the end frame of the container moves out of square.

Planning permission for shipping containers varies by location. Please do not assume because the container is a movable object that you do not require planning permission. If you intend placing for any length of time, we suggest contacting your local authority.

The container is capable of supporting a full load on its four bottom corners and block pavers. Alternatively, rail sleepers are suitable materials to support the container, which is best lifted from the ground to help prevent any potential damage to the container or its content due to damp.
